Cep Wines is a second label of Peay Vineyards. Peay is most noted for Pinot Noir grown on their cool Sonoma Coast site. The estate is too cold for Sauvignon Blanc, but they found an excellent source for that grape in the Hopkins Ranch of the Russian River Valley. The Cep 2024 Hopkins Ranch Sauvignon Blanc is impressive and appealing, with a vivacity and complexity not often found in Golden State Sauvignon Blancs. It is reminiscent of a fresh Sancerre in its purity and lively style. The nose is bright and forward with aromas of grapefruit, pear and lime fruits backed by hints of flowers and herbs. Richly textured on the palate, it offers layers of ripe grapefruit, tropical and lime fruits plus the classic grassy, herbal notes of Sauvignon. It is a beautifully balanced white that is delicious now and will drink well for another year or two.
